Located in Trabzon's historic center, in the upper neighborhoods of the Ortahisar district, the Manastir (Monastery) Fountain is a hidden witness to the water culture of Ottoman-era architecture. With ornamentation worked into its stones and a stepped pool design, this monument, dating to the mid-16th century, played a central role in the social and religious life of the nearby monastery buildings; it was a place of spiritual refreshment and ablution for the people and the dervishes. The fountain's water channels, through stone conduits still partly visible, carried clear water brought down from the mountains to the city center; this multilayered system is a continuation of Trabzon's medieval water-architecture tradition. Bearing traces of local construction and craftsmanship, its capital and roof reflect the mastery of the region's stone-working artisans. An interesting fact: the inscriptions near the fountain contain prayer texts about the abundance and bounty of water, regarding the water source as a sacred heritage. On the road by the Ortahisar cemetery, in the morning hours there is a chance to see the period's architecture and its surrounding design in full.
